Servings: 8 servings
See More Parents Recipes
Ingredients
 
savings in
 
  • 2  cups  vanilla or chocolate ice creamOn Sale
  • 2  cups  chopped chocolate (any kind)On Sale
  • 1/2  cup  assorted toppings, such as sprinkles, toffee bits, and coconutOn Sale

Directions
1.
Cut the tops off eight 7-ounce paper cups to make a mold that's an inch deep. Pack the ice cream into the molds. Use the tip of a knife to make a slit in the side of each mold and insert wooden sticks. Cover and freeze until firm, about 3 hours.
2.
Meanwhile, melt chocolate over low heat in a small saucepan. Allow to cool slightly. Remove pops from molds and spoon chocolate on evenly. Sprinkle with your favorite topping. Serve immediately or insert sticks into a piece of Styrofoam and freeze until ready to eat. Wrap in plastic for longer storage.
